The 90 minute CD R printable is a type of recordable compact disc that can store up to 90 minutes of music or 800 MB of data. This makes them ideal for creating mix CDs, backing up important files, and sharing large amounts of data with others. The printable surface of the disc allows users to add custom labels, titles, and artwork, making them a great option for independent musicians, businesses, and individuals who want to create professional-looking discs.
